hu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]从零开始,服务器数据库搭建全攻略|服务器数据库搭建方法,服务器数据库搭建

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本攻略全面介绍Linux操作系统下服务器数据库搭建过程,涵盖从零起步的基础知识到实际操作技巧。详细解析服务器配置、数据库选型及安装步骤,提供高效、安全的搭建方案。无论新手或资深IT人员,皆可按图索骥,快速掌握服务器数据库搭建要领,确保系统稳定运行,满足多样化业务需求。

本文目录导读:

  1. 服务器数据库搭建的前期准备
  2. 服务器环境搭建
  3. 数据库软件安装与配置
  4. 数据库优化与调优
  5. 数据库备份与恢复
  6. 数据库监控与维护
  7. 常见问题与解决方案
  8. 案例分析

在当今信息化时代,数据已经成为企业和社会的核心资产,如何高效、安全地存储和管理这些数据,成为了每一个IT从业者必须面对的问题,服务器数据库搭建作为数据管理的基础环节,其重要性不言而喻,本文将详细介绍服务器数据库搭建的各个环节,帮助读者从零开始,掌握这一关键技能。

服务器数据库搭建的前期准备

1、需求分析

在开始搭建服务器数据库之前,首先要进行详细的需求分析,明确数据库的用途、预计的数据量、并发访问量等,这些因素将直接影响数据库的选择和配置。

2、硬件选型

根据需求分析的结果,选择合适的硬件设备,主要包括服务器、存储设备和网络设备,服务器的CPU、内存、硬盘等配置需要根据数据库的规模和性能要求来确定。

3、软件选择

常见的数据库软件有MySQL、Oracle、SQL Server、PostgreSQL等,每种数据库软件都有其特点和适用场景,需要根据实际需求进行选择。

服务器环境搭建

1、操作系统安装

选择合适的操作系统,如Linux、Windows Server等,Linux因其稳定性和开源特性,被广泛应用于服务器环境。

2、网络配置

配置服务器的IP地址、子网掩码、网关等网络参数,确保服务器能够正常连接到网络。

3、安全设置

加强服务器的安全防护,包括设置强密码、关闭不必要的服务和端口、安装防火墙等。

数据库软件安装与配置

1、下载与安装

从官方渠道下载所选数据库软件的安装包,按照安装向导进行安装,注意选择合适的安装路径和组件。

2、初始配置

安装完成后,进行初始配置,包括设置数据库管理员密码、配置数据库存储路径、设置字符集等。

3、服务启动与验证

启动数据库服务,使用数据库管理工具连接数据库,验证安装是否成功。

数据库优化与调优

1、参数调优

根据数据库的实际运行情况,调整数据库的参数配置,如内存分配、连接数、缓冲区大小等,以提高数据库的性能。

2、索引优化

合理创建和使用索引,可以显著提高数据库的查询效率,需要根据查询频率和数据的更新频率来设计索引。

3、存储优化

优化数据的存储方式,如分区表、压缩存储等,可以提高数据的读写速度和存储效率。

数据库备份与恢复

1、备份策略

制定合理的备份策略,包括全量备份、增量备份、差异备份等,确保数据的安全性和可恢复性。

2、备份实施

使用数据库自带的备份工具或第三方备份软件,定期进行数据备份,并验证备份文件的完整性。

3、恢复演练

定期进行数据恢复演练,确保在发生数据丢失或损坏时,能够快速恢复数据。

数据库监控与维护

1、监控工具

使用专业的数据库监控工具,实时监控数据库的运行状态,包括CPU使用率、内存占用、磁盘I/O等。

2、日志分析

定期分析数据库的日志文件,发现并解决潜在的问题,如慢查询、死锁等。

3、定期维护

定期进行数据库的维护操作,如数据清理、索引重建、统计信息更新等,保持数据库的最佳性能。

常见问题与解决方案

1、连接问题

数据库连接失败可能是由于网络配置错误、服务未启动、权限不足等原因引起的,需要逐一排查。

2、性能瓶颈

数据库性能瓶颈可能出现在CPU、内存、磁盘I/O等环节,需要通过性能分析工具找出瓶颈所在,并进行针对性优化。

3、数据不一致

数据不一致可能是由于并发操作、事务处理不当等原因引起的,需要通过事务管理和锁机制来保证数据的一致性。

案例分析

以某电商平台的数据库搭建为例,详细介绍了从需求分析、硬件选型、软件安装、配置优化到备份恢复的全过程,通过实际案例,帮助读者更好地理解和应用所学知识。

服务器数据库搭建是一项复杂而重要的工作,需要综合考虑硬件、软件、网络、安全等多个方面,通过本文的详细介绍,希望能够帮助读者掌握服务器数据库搭建的基本方法和技巧,为今后的工作打下坚实的基础。

相关关键词

服务器, 数据库, 搭建, 需求分析, 硬件选型, 软件选择, 操作系统, 网络配置, 安全设置, 安装, 配置, 优化, 调优, 索引, 存储, 备份, 恢复, 监控, 维护, 日志, 性能, 瓶颈, 一致性, 事务, 案例, 电商平台, MySQL, Oracle, SQL Server, PostgreSQL, Linux, Windows Server, IP地址, 防火墙, 内存, CPU, 硬盘, 连接数, 缓冲区, 分区表, 压缩存储, 全量备份, 增量备份, 差异备份, 监控工具, 慢查询, 死锁, 数据清理, 索引重建, 统计信息, 网络错误, 服务启动, 权限, 并发操作, 事务管理, 锁机制, 性能分析, 数据安全, 数据管理, IT从业者, 信息时代, 核心资产, 数据存储, 数据效率, 数据读写, 数据完整性, 数据丢失, 数据损坏, 数据恢复, 数据监控, 数据维护, 数据分析, 数据问题, 数据解决方案

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

服务器数据库搭建:服务器搭建sql数据库环境

原文链接:,转发请注明来源!